Bulls Say, Bears Say
Bulls Say
Strong Balance SheetThe company’s materially lower leverage provides durable financial flexibility: it can fund capex, absorb cyclical downturns, and pursue investments without heavy refinancing. Conservative capital structure supports resilience across multi-quarter industry swings and preserves strategic optionality.
Solid Cash GenerationRobust operating and free cash flow in 2025 demonstrates the business can self-fund operations and capital needs. Reliable internal cash reduces dependence on external financing, supports dividends and reinvestment, and underpins long-term survivability despite cyclical revenue swings.
Higher-value Product MixDownstream processing and value-added products create structural margin advantages versus commodity float glass. Vertical capabilities and product diversification improve pricing power, support more stable revenue per unit, and anchor long-term competitiveness in construction and automotive markets.
Bears Say
Sharp Revenue DeclineSubstantial, consecutive revenue contractions indicate weakened end-market demand or loss of volumes. Such scale erosion undermines fixed-cost absorption and operating leverage, making margin recovery and sustainable profitability harder without a durable market rebound or new revenue sources.
Margin CompressionA multi-year collapse in net margin signals structural pressure from pricing, costs, or mix shifts. Persistently lower margins reduce reinvestment capacity and return on equity, limiting the firm’s ability to grow earnings per share and weakening resilience to future input-cost shocks.
Volatile Cash FlowsMarked FCF variability reduces predictability for capital allocation, dividends, and debt servicing. Even with a strong 2025 result, volatility complicates medium-term planning, increases execution risk for growth initiatives, and can constrain consistent shareholder returns.

Company Description
Xinyi Glass Holdings
Xinyi Glass Holdings Limited functions as an investment holding company, primarily involved in the production and distribution of diverse glass products, such as automotive, construction, and float glass, catering to industrial and commercial requirements. Its operations are structured into three main divisions: Float Glass, Automobile Glass, and Architectural Glass. Beyond its core glass manufacturing, the company has diversified its ventures to include the production of automotive rubber and plastic components, electronic glass, and engagement in glass trading and research. Its broader portfolio encompasses offering logistics and supply chain services, operating a wind farm for electricity generation, and fabricating automatic machinery for solar and other glass-related industries. The company also holds and manages properties and car parks. Xinyi Glass serves a broad spectrum of clients, from automotive manufacturers and repair services to construction, engineering, and various wholesale and distribution businesses within the glass and related industries. The company boasts a significant global presence, distributing its products across approximately 140 countries and regions worldwide, including mainland China, Hong Kong, the United States, Canada, Australia, New Zealand, and numerous markets throughout Asia, the Middle East, Europe, Africa, and the Americas. Established in 1988, Xinyi Glass Holdings Limited is headquartered in Kwun Tong, Hong Kong.
